Output e8570883b96660331494337370aa323a6e16765c114b4f4bae84a0562b0e7144:1
- value
- 31574150
- script pubkey
- OP_0 OP_PUSHBYTES_20 18a83a5ab394c52bea495e7e5687881740bc10c7
- address
- bc1qrz5r5k4njnzjh6jftel9dpugzaqtcyx826palf
- transaction
- e8570883b96660331494337370aa323a6e16765c114b4f4bae84a0562b0e7144